## Part A: Convert each improper fraction to a mixed number
An improper fraction has a numerator ≥ denominator. To convert it to a mixed number, divide the numerator by the denominator:
- The quotient becomes the whole number.
- The remainder becomes the new numerator.
- The denominator stays the same.
---
1) \(\frac{9}{5}\)
Divide 9 ÷ 5 = 1 remainder 4
→ Mixed number: \(1 \frac{4}{5}\)
✔ Answer: \(1 \frac{4}{5}\)
---
2) \(\frac{53}{12}\)
53 ÷ 12 = 4 remainder 5 (since 12 × 4 = 48; 53 - 48 = 5)
→ Mixed number: \(4 \frac{5}{12}\)
✔ Answer: \(4 \frac{5}{12}\)
---
3) \(\frac{10}{3}\)
10 ÷ 3 = 3 remainder 1
→ Mixed number: \(3 \frac{1}{3}\)
✔ Answer: \(3 \frac{1}{3}\)
---
4) \(\frac{8}{7}\)
8 ÷ 7 = 1 remainder 1
→ Mixed number: \(1 \frac{1}{7}\)
✔ Answer: \(1 \frac{1}{7}\)
---
5) \(\frac{65}{11}\)
65 ÷ 11 = 5 remainder 10 (11 × 5 = 55; 65 - 55 = 10)
→ Mixed number: \(5 \frac{10}{11}\)
✔ Answer: \(5 \frac{10}{11}\)
---
6) \(\frac{31}{4}\)
31 ÷ 4 = 7 remainder 3
→ Mixed number: \(7 \frac{3}{4}\)
✔ Answer: \(7 \frac{3}{4}\)
---
7) \(\frac{29}{6}\)
29 ÷ 6 = 4 remainder 5
→ Mixed number: \(4 \frac{5}{6}\)
✔ Answer: \(4 \frac{5}{6}\)
---
8) \(\frac{74}{9}\)
74 ÷ 9 = 8 remainder 2 (9 × 8 = 72; 74 - 72 = 2)
→ Mixed number: \(8 \frac{2}{9}\)
✔ Answer: \(8 \frac{2}{9}\)
---
## Part B: Rewrite each mixed number as an improper fraction
To convert a mixed number to an improper fraction:
- Multiply the whole number by the denominator.
- Add the numerator.
- Keep the same denominator.
Formula:
\[
\text{Improper Fraction} = \frac{(\text{Whole Number} \times \text{Denominator}) + \text{Numerator}}{\text{Denominator}}
\]

1) \(9 \frac{3}{10}\)
= \(\frac{(9 × 10) + 3}{10} = \frac{90 + 3}{10} = \frac{93}{10}\)
✔ Answer: \(\frac{93}{10}\)
---
2) \(7 \frac{1}{2}\)
= \(\frac{(7 × 2) + 1}{2} = \frac{14 + 1}{2} = \frac{15}{2}\)
✔ Answer: \(\frac{15}{2}\)
---
3) \(1 \frac{1}{6}\)
= \(\frac{(1 × 6) + 1}{6} = \frac{6 + 1}{6} = \frac{7}{6}\)
✔ Answer: \(\frac{7}{6}\)
---
4) \(2 \frac{6}{11}\)
= \(\frac{(2 × 11) + 6}{11} = \frac{22 + 6}{11} = \frac{28}{11}\)
✔ Answer: \(\frac{28}{11}\)
---
5) \(4 \frac{5}{8}\)
= \(\frac{(4 × 8) + 5}{8} = \frac{32 + 5}{8} = \frac{37}{8}\)
✔ Answer: \(\frac{37}{8}\)
---
6) \(1 \frac{3}{5}\)
= \(\frac{(1 × 5) + 3}{5} = \frac{5 + 3}{5} = \frac{8}{5}\)
✔ Answer: \(\frac{8}{5}\)
---
7) \(6 \frac{2}{7}\)
= \(\frac{(6 × 7) + 2}{7} = \frac{42 + 2}{7} = \frac{44}{7}\)
✔ Answer: \(\frac{44}{7}\)
---
8) \(5 \frac{8}{9}\)
= \(\frac{(5 × 9) + 8}{9} = \frac{45 + 8}{9} = \frac{53}{9}\)
✔ Answer: \(\frac{53}{9}\)
